>데이터 베이스 >MySQL 튜토리얼 >mysql에서 루트 비밀번호를 설정하는 방법

mysql에서 루트 비밀번호를 설정하는 방법

PHPz
PHPz원래의
2023-04-20 10:10:443347검색

作为数据库管理系统中最常用的一种,MySQL的安装和配置工作是我们在进行后端开发时必须掌握的一项技能,尤其是MySQL root密码的设置。

MySQL root账户是MySQL数据库的最高权限账户,具有创建和删除数据库、用户账号、修改权限等功能。对于MySQL数据库安全而言,root账户的密码设置至关重要。下面我们将详细介绍如何设置MySQL root密码。

  1. 首先,登录MySQL

在终端中输入以下命令,登录到MySQL:

mysql -u root

如果你在MySQL安装时设置了密码,则需要输入密码。如果第一次登录或者没有设置密码,则留空直接回车进入。

  1. 修改MySQL root密码

在进入MySQL的客户端之后,我们需要修改root账户的密码。在终端中输入以下命令:

ALTER USER 'root'@'localhost' IDENTIFIED BY 'newpassword';

其中,将“newpassword”换成你自己所想要设置的密码即可。

  1. 确认密码修改成功

在修改密码后,我们需要确认密码修改是否成功。在终端中输入以下命令:

SELECT User, Host, Password FROM mysql.user;

查看输出的结果中,root账户的密码是否为我们刚刚设置的新密码。

  1. 更改配置文件

除了在MySQL客户端中修改密码,我们也需要修改MySQL的配置文件。在终端中输入以下命令:

s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f

在文件中找到以下内容:

#bind-address = 127.0.0.1

将其修改为:

bind-address = 0.0.0.0

保存文件并退出。这一步的目的是使MySQL服务器能够在本地以外的其他计算机上访问。

  1. 重启MySQL

在终端中输入以下命令,重启MySQL服务器:

sudo service mysql restart

重启之后,我们可以在其他计算机上使用root账户进行MySQL数据库的访问,使用刚刚设置的新密码即可。

总结

在使用MySQL进行后端开发中,root账户的密码设置是一个必不可少的过程,也是一项非常重要的安全措施。通过上面的介绍,相信大家已经掌握了如何设置MySQL root密码的方法。希望本文对大家能有所帮助。

위 내용은 mysql에서 루트 비밀번호를 설정하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.